Your role at Dynatrace

 

The IT Support Engineer is responsible for providing local and remote technical services to Dynatrace employees worldwide through a variety of media including support portals, email, chat and videoconferencing. The role requires strong technical analysis and problem-solving skills and operates autonomously to implement proactive customer technical solutions. Ability to work within a global team is imperative and experience working internationally/across multiple time zones is preferable. You must have a desire to work within and contribute to global procedures and practices.

 

Responsibilities:

 

  • Responsible for end-to-end Incident, Service Request and Problem management including qualified escalation to Business Systems and Infrastructure specialists where necessary.
  • Responsible for executing local and regional projects as part of global programs such as the deployment of new client hardware and software technologies; asset logistics and demand management; office relocations.
  • Responsible for creating and maintaining process & workflow documentation related to Service Desk operations for both internal and customer use cases.
  • Provides regional and global client support as required; primarily the support and maintenance of client hardware including MacBooks, and PC laptops.
  • Maintain and provide technical support for audiovisual (AV) systems across the office, including Zoom Rooms, training rooms, and conference rooms, ensuring seamless operation and minimal downtime.
  • Provides suggestions and feedback for team & workplace operational process improvement.
